Adjunct Assistant Professor of International Business

Education

BCom, University of British Columbia
MBA, University of Toronto
MSSc, Maxwell School, Syracuse University
PhD, The Fletcher School

Professional Activities

Has taught finance in the Fletcher Summer School since 2003. Assistant Professor, Finance, Bentley College - teaches International Finance, Capital Markets II and Project Finance. Consultant and international financial adviser specializing in banking and financial services and risk management, especially country risk. Special interests in international Project Finance and developing country financial systems and capital markets. Taught in Armenia in August 2004.

Research Interests

International finance and capital markets, economics and political business cycles, especially as these areas relate to multinational financial services, valuation, international project finance, country risk management and international relations.
